Incident report/injury to a police officer
02/06/2024 at around 0800hrs while CPL was on duty along Kamiti Road at Mirema Junction controlling traffic, the officer spotted a motor vehicle which was making a U-turn on the road causing obstruction to other road users. 

When he approached the said motor vehicle, the driver hit the road kerb and got stuck. In the process, the officer managed to enter the vehicle on the front passenger's seat and instruct the driver to drive to the police station. 

On reaching opposite Quick Mart, the driver suddenly stopped and drew a sword from under the seat. The officer jumped out of the vehicle for his own safety, and the driver followed him with blows and kicks. He fell into the trench, and in the process, the driver took his police pocket phone battery and left with it.

 The officer was rescued by members of the public and later sought first aid at Crestview Mother and Child Wellness Centre Kasarani and was referred to Mama Lucy for further treatment. One accomplice, namely Peter Kiragu, is in custody. Efforts to trace the motor vehicle and the driver underway.
